Cran Sake Cocktail

Elevate your cocktail game with this refreshing and subtly sweet Cran Sake Cocktail, a perfect fusion of fruity cranberry juice and smooth, delicate sake. With just five minutes of prep time, this vibrant drink blends simple syrup and a bright splash of fresh lime juice for perfectly balanced sweetness and tang. Shaken with ice for a crisp chill, it's served over fresh ice in a rocks glass, then elegantly garnished with fresh cranberries and a lime wheel for a pop of color. Prep Time:5 mins
Cook Time:0 mins
Total Time:5 mins
Servings: 1

Ingredients

  • 4 oz Cranberry juice
  • 3 oz Sake
  • 0.5 oz Simple syrup
  • 0.5 oz Fresh lime juice
  • 1 cup Ice
  • 3 pieces Fresh cranberries (for garnish)
  • 1 piece Lime wheel (for garnish)

Directions

Step 1

Fill a cocktail shaker with ice.

Step 2

Add cranberry juice, sake, simple syrup, and fresh lime juice to the shaker.

Step 3

Shake vigorously for about 10-15 seconds to ensure all ingredients are well mixed and chilled.

Step 4

Strain the mixture into a chilled rocks glass filled with fresh ice.

Step 5

Garnish with fresh cranberries and a lime wheel on the rim of the glass.

Step 6

Serve immediately and enjoy your Cran Sake Cocktail!
